# Env vars — Crumbline order-cutoff rule

Crumbline's bakery service enforces the daily order cutoff via two vars. CUTOFF_LOCAL_TIME sets the deadline (24h format, default 14:00). CUTOFF_TZ must match the storefront's timezone or orders get rejected early. Changing either requires a service restart; the rule is cached at boot. On-call: never edit these during the cutoff window itself. The cutoff notifier also posts to the kitchen display service and authenticates with a shared secret, set on the line immediately following:

sealed setting: ARCHIVE_KEY3=8d0

# Break-Glass: Catalog Cache Invalidation

Scope: the Pinrow product catalog at Veldstone Retail. If stale prices persist after a purge and the Hollowmere invalidation queue is wedged, use break-glass to flush the edge tier directly. Contractors: get verbal sign-off from the catalog lead first. Steps: open the Hollowmere admin shell, select emergency-flush, confirm the tenant, and run it once — repeated flushes thrash the origin. Access is logged and expires after 20 minutes. Unseal the admin shell with the passphrase below.

recovery phrase for kahop-tajog: istix-casvan

Handover: role-based access in Stonewick Wiki. RBAC now enforced at the plugin API boundary; plugins declare required scopes in their manifest or get read-only by default. Legacy plugins without manifests break after v3.2 — warn your users. Scope escalation requests go through the admin console, not code. Migration guide is in the developer portal. For API questions, scope grants, or manifest review, contact the maintainer named below.

named custodian: Belius Casath Ulaix Sorius